The March 2020 Networking at Noon will be focused on Marketing and Media. Our panel will explore the Marketing and Media Industry, and topics relevant to help business owners reach strategic audiences. Questions and answers are welcome!
Panelists will be: Brian Lilly, Owner of WENY; Laurie Linn, Owner and President of Communique; Melissa Gattine, Executive Director of Marketing and Enrollment Strategy at Ithaca College and Todd Mallinson, Owner and President of Vizella Media.

Economic Summit
The Tompkins Chamber presents key local issues impacting local businesses and developers, policy issues impacting the business community, and local insights from participants in a national economic outlook survey. Partnering with Ithaca Area Economic Development (IAED), the event includes important updates about our economy, workforce, upcoming projects, and strategies to move forward and achieve a sustainable economic recovery.
